Acquisition Information
The papers of George Kennan, explorer, journalist, and author were given to the Library of Congress by Kennan in 1903 and by his wife, Emeline Weld Kennan, from 1925 to 1937. An addition was purchased in 1969.
Processing History
The Kennan Papers were processed in 1951 and expanded in 1973. The finding aid was revised in 2013.
Transfers
Items have been transferred from the Manuscript Division to other custodial divisions of the Library. Photographs, prints, and drawings have been transferred to the Prints and Photographs Division. Maps have been transferred to the Geography and Map Division. All transfers are identified in these divisions as part of the George Kennan Papers.
